Choosing a Self Propelled Wheelchair With Suspension

Self-propelled wheelchairs promote independence by allowing individuals to determine their own the speed, direction and destination. They also help improve upper body strength and cardiovascular health.

Wheelchair suspension helps absorb sharp shocks like drops from curbs or thresholds and also reduce the vibration that is transferred to the MWU. In-wheel suspension is a promising alternative to front-caster suspension.

Seat Size

Getting the correct seat size is crucial to ensure that a self-propelled wheelchair with suspension offers the most comfortable experience. A seat too small puts unnecessary pressure on bones and muscles and a seat that is too large can lead to an uncomfortable posture. It is recommended that you visit a wheelchair-friendly seating clinic prior to buying to ensure that your seat is set in the best way for your specific disability.

The frame material you choose will also affect your comfort. Steel frames are strong and provide a lot of adjustability. They can be very heavy, and can cause sores when used for long distances. Aluminium is a lighter option and more flexible. The majority of aluminum wheelchairs are equipped with a removable footrest to reduce weight when not being used.

Carbon fibre is the lightest of all frame materials however it is comparatively more expensive and is only available on top-of-the-line models. Despite its high cost carbon is extremely strong and durability. This makes it a great choice for use in wheelchairs with sporty designs and models that are high-performance.

Empowering Independence

A self-propelled, suspension-equipped wheelchair is an excellent way to go out and about whether for everyday or leisure use. The right frame and accessories will increase your comfort, safety and efficiency. Customizing your wheelchair to be a perfect fit for your lifestyle is a great option to personalize it.

The Drive Medical Enigma K-Chair, for instance, revolutionizes wheelchair comfort by adjusting the spring suspension. The rear shock absorbers can be adjusted in height to minimize uneven surfaces and enhance the comfort of riding. Adjustable anti-tip tires and front suspensions increase the safety of riders and make climbing kerbs more comfortable. A padded backrest with a desk-style design and one-touch height-adjustable armrests complete the set.

Seat to Side Height

Many wheelchair users can gain from adjustments to the frame or seat cushion, as well as backrests that allow users sit comfortably with good posture. If they don't, their posture may be affected negatively, which can cause fatigue, pain, decreased self-esteem, and even limited mobility.

During the seating evaluation We evaluate a client's muscles' strength, range of motion and strength to determine the best wheelchair for them. It's also important to think about the hips' bone structure, their position and other medical conditions. This can affect their seating system as well as the way they operate their wheelchair.

The height of the front and rear seats is crucial in determining the seating position with respect to the wheels. If a person is sitting too high above their wheels, they'll be unable to reach the rims of their hands effectively. You should be able to reach the wheel hub when you hang your hands at your side.
